[Killietalk] N. virgatus recollected
I just returned from Al Fula, Sudan and collected a few specimens of N.
virgatus. This collecting trip was very difficult. An enormous effort was
made to collect this fish. Just slogging through the mud (never been in mud
like this) in this heat was an incredible strain not to mention being
relentlessly hasseled by the Sudaneese police (American policy is not very
popular here right now).
Breeding fish here is very difficult (Oh how I wish I had my fishroom set up
now) but I will try my best to get eggs. I have promised several of you eggs
as I collect them and I am hoping that through these expereinced breeders, this
fish can be enjoyed by more hobbyists in the AKA. No promises but I will try.
I am again reminded of the great value the AKA has in helping to distribute
fish that are both difficult and expensive to obtain in the wild.
